					<description><![CDATA[I do a full second revision before I let anyone see any of the story. I usually let DH read it at this point and get his feedback.

Then I do another revision.

Then I turn to a trusty beta reader. She reads the whole thing and helps me see plot holes and character stuff I might have missed.

Then, I make her changes, assuming I agreed with them. I then do another revision. At this point, I think I might be ready to start querying.

Not there yet. Have the work right now with the beta reader.

Always nervous about critique groups now. I was in one years ago, and I might as well have given my work to a kindergarten classroom for the quality I was getting from it.]]></description>
